
A constant flow of negative news has become part of our daily lives. But is the news we consume giving us an accurate picture of the world we live in? Is there a better way to deliver bad news that doesn’t end with doom and gloom? April and Christa talk with Dr. Karen McIntyre to explore these questions.
Dr. McIntyre is an Associate Professor of Journalism and Director of Graduate Studies for VCU’s Richard T. Robertson School of Media and Culture. Her research primarily focuses on constructive journalism, an emerging form of journalism that involves creating more productive and solution-focused stories.
